Mr Mamoon Alyah is a Chartered Electrical Engineer (UK) and a Professional Engineer (USA) with over 35 years of experience investigating complex incidents involving electrical power systems (power generation, transmission, and distribution), including turbine failure (gas and steam), wind power (onshore and offshore), solar power (PV and CSP) in addition to geothermal, hydro and other energy power systems.
Mr Alyah has investigated and prepared hundreds of reports on the root cause of failures in numerous engineering systems including ESS (Energy Storage Systems), batteries, transformers, switchgear assemblies, cables in addition to other power equipment.
In addition, he is also a recognised expert in damage and failure if SCADA, PLC, medical equipment, IT and communication, boilers, CNC Machines, conveyor systems, HVAC, refrigeration, fire alarm and firefighting, rotating machinery and turbines, cranes and other types of equipment and machinery.
He also investigated major and complex incidents in industrial plants providing opinions on root cause and developing reinstatement options.
Mr Alyah has been qualified as an expert witness in different jurisdictions (USA, UK, EU, Middle East, Australia and Asia) preparing expert reports and giving evidence in legal proceedings in many jurisdictions in matters involving electrical energy networks, power equipment and apparatus, construction disputes, and defect claims (design, manufacturing and workmanship).
Mr Alyah has authored several articles published in leading industry magazines, in addition to being a frequent lecturer on a variety of topics to different organisations and groups such as the CILA, OEC London and Dubai, IMIA among many others.
He hosts a monthly webinar for insurance industry professionals on topics covering energy and engineering claims, including claims related to electrical engineering, mechanical engineering, and renewable energy.
